IoT(物聯網)是指將物體與互聯網相連,形成一個互聯網中的大型系統(tǒng),從而實現物體之間的智能互聯。在這個系統(tǒng)中,數據是一個至關重要的部分,我們需要安全、高效地存儲和管理這些數據,這就需要使用數據庫。
MySQL 是一個非常流行的數據庫管理系統(tǒng),其具有高效、可擴展和開源等優(yōu)點,正是越來越多的 IoT 平臺選擇了 MySQL 作為其數據存儲和管理的后臺。以下是使用 MySQL 存儲和管理 IoT 數據的示例代碼:
//連接數據庫 $conn = mysqli_connect("localhost", "用戶名", "密碼", "數據庫名"); //傳感器采集數據 $temperature = $_GET['temperature']; $humidity = $_GET['humidity']; //將數據存儲到數據庫中 $sql = "INSERT INTO sensor_data (temperature, humidity) VALUES ('$temperature', '$humidity')"; mysqli_query($conn, $sql); //關閉數據庫連接 mysqli_close($conn);
上述代碼中,我們首先使用 mysqli_connect() 函數連接數據庫,然后通過傳感器采集數據,并使用 SQL 語句將數據存儲到 MySQL 數據庫中。最后,我們使用 mysqli_close() 函數關閉數據庫連接。
在實際的 IoT 系統(tǒng)中,我們還可以使用 MySQL 的其他功能,如數據查詢、數據統(tǒng)計及數據分析等。因此,MySQL 是一個非常強大的數據管理工具,可以幫助我們高效、安全地管理 IoT 數據。
下一篇mysql 5.3.1